Staff at Isle Royale National Park (ISRO), Apostle Islands National Lakeshore (APIS) and Pictured Rocks National Lakeshore (PIRO) have identified rock pools as understudied habitats in need of investigation due to their potentially unique biota and vulnerability to imminent stressors. Preliminary surveys have shown that Isle Royale National Park (ISRO) shoreline rock pools are used by rare species such as the boreal chorus frog and other arctic disjunct organisms. At Apostle Islands National Lakeshore (APIS) similar habitats are known to support arctic disjunct flora, but pool fauna have not been systematically surveyed. All three parks are located near commercial shipping lanes on Lake Superior, making them susceptible to catastrophic events such as a shipping‐related spills. Given their small size and shallow depths, rock pools and their biota are also highly susceptible to climate change and impacts from visitors. Natural resources staff at all three parks are concerned about this vulnerability, and consider rock pool habitat to be important to park biodiversity. No studies have addressed rock pools at APIS or PIRO, and previous rock pool studies at ISRO by outside investigators have focused on mainly theoretical questions focused on restricted components of the fauna. The mapping and biological studies of shoreline rock pools in three Lake Superior National Parks project will provide critical baseline data on the distribution, chemistry, biology, and ecology of these unique and dynamic ecosystems in the three Lake Superior parks. The primary goals of this study are: • Survey the distribution of rock pools along shoreline areas of Isle Royale, Pictured Rocks, and Apostle Islands National Parks. • Characterize the physical properties and water chemistry of these pools or a representative subset of pools. • Characterize the biological structure of these pools or a representative subset of pools, including algae, microinvertebrates, macroinvertebrates and vertebrates. • Develop mapping and ecological assessment protocol for rock pools. • Develop long term monitoring plans for rock pools at these Parks. The Apostle Islands rock pools were studied in both spring and fall of 2010 by Toben Lafrançois (SCWRS, field coordinator for this project at APIS and PIRO), Mark Edlund (SCWRS), Alaina Fedie (intern, SCWRS), Leonard Ferrington, Jr. (University of Minnesota), Jay Glase (NPS Regional Biologist) and Joan Elias (GLKN). Ted Gostomski (GLKN biologist and science writer) was the boat captain and guide on both occasions.
